Following the 1978 season and Super Bowl XIII, Pugh retired on January 29, 1979,[11] after helping the Cowboys win two Super Bowls, five NFC Championships, qualify for the NFL post-season in 12 out of 14 seasons, and played in a then league record 23 playoff games. Pugh was the first Dallas player to lead the team in sacks five straight seasons (1968 to 1972). Jethro Pugh Jr. (July 3, 1944 January 7, 2015) was an American football defensive tackle in the National Football League (NFL) for the Dallas Cowboys for fourteen seasons. He was, by most accounts, an underappreciated cog on a fierce defensive squad whose other members at various times included players who landed in the Hall of Fame, among them tackles Bob Lilly and Randy White and the defensive back Mel Renfro, as well as a host of fabled Cowboys, including linebackers Chuck Howley and Lee Roy Jordan and the lineman Ed (Too Tall) Jones. Kramer's block cleared the way for Bart Starr to score on a 1-yard quarterback sneak with 16 seconds remaining, lifting Vince Lombardi's team to a 2117 victory and an unprecedented third consecutive title game win in 15F (26C) weather at Lambeau Field. IRVING, Texas -- Jethro Pugh played alongside Hall of Famers Bob Lilly and Randy White in a long career as a defensive tackle for the Dallas Cowboys, which may explain why he was among the most unsung Super Bowl winners in the franchise's storied history. When Pugh started, he had to compete for attention with future Hall of Famer Bob Lilly and George Andrie; when they retired, Pugh played in the same defensive line with Randy White, Harvey Martin, and Ed "Too Tall" Jones. He led the Cowboys in sacks each season from 1968 to 1972 with a high mark of 15.5 in 1968, a team record that stood until 2010 when DeMarcus Ware reached six straight seasons. With Pugh as a starter at left defensive tackle, the Cowboys lost in Super Bowl V to the Baltimore Colts in 1971, defeated the Miami Dolphins in Super Bowl VI in 1972, lost to the Steelers in Super Bowl X in 1976 and then whipped the Denver Broncos in Super Bowl XII in 1978. Geoffrey McIntyre Rowe (8 March 1948 - 14 December 2021), known by his stage name Jethro, was a British stand-up comedian and singer from Cornwall . Born in Windsor, North Carolina, Pugh graduated from its W. S. Etheridge High School and enrolled at nearby Elizabeth City State College at the age of 16.
